Who penned the motto each one teach one?

The missionary Frank Laubach used the slogan in the 20th Century, but it was around before that. Probably nobody know who said it first.

How does Danielle know frank and mike from American pickers?

Danielle Colby Cushman had been a friend of Mike Wolfe for ten years before the show started.
